Portraiture is a specialized Lightroom plugin designed to automate the complex process of skin retouching. Version 4.0.3 Build 4033 represents a significant evolution in the tool's history, introducing AI-driven masking to help photographers achieve professional results without the tedious manual labor of traditional frequency separation. Understanding the Core Features of Portraiture 4.0.3
The primary appeal of the Imagenomic Portraiture plugin lies in its ability to selectively smooth skin while preserving essential textures like pores, eyelashes, and hair. In Build 4033, the engine has been refined to better distinguish between skin tones and background elements, reducing the "plastic" look often associated with lower-quality filters.
AI-Enabled Masking: This build utilizes advanced algorithms to automatically detect skin, hair, and eyes, allowing for targeted adjustments.
Preset Library: Users can choose from a variety of built-in presets ranging from "Light" to "Smoothing: High," providing a starting point for different lighting conditions.
Fine-Tuning Controls: Beyond automation, the plugin offers sliders for Detail Smoothing, Skin Tones Masking, and Enhancements like warmth and brightness.
Non-Destructive Workflow: When used within Adobe Lightroom, the plugin typically creates a copy of the original file (TIFF or PSD), ensuring your RAW data remains untouched. How to Install and Use the DMG File on macOS

If you are a portrait photographer or high-volume retoucher, you likely understand the struggle of balancing speed with natural-looking results. The release of Imagenomic Portraiture 4 (specifically version 4.0.3 build 4033) marks a significant update for Adobe Lightroom users on macOS, offering a more refined approach to skin smoothing and blemish removal.
Here is a deep dive into what makes this specific build a staple for modern editing workflows. What is Imagenomic Portraiture 4?
Imagenomic Portraiture is a dedicated plugin designed to automate the labor-intensive process of retouching skin. While Lightroom has improved its "Texture" and "Clarity" sliders over the years, they often lack the surgical precision required for professional beauty work.
The 4.0.3 build 4033 update focuses on enhancing the AI-driven masking engine, allowing the software to distinguish between skin tones and other details (like hair, eyes, or clothing) with much higher accuracy than previous versions. Key Features of the 4.0.3 Build
The .dmg file for macOS users brings several critical optimizations:
Advanced Masking Engine: Version 4 introduced a more robust AI that automatically detects skin areas. Build 4033 refines this further, reducing the "haloing" effect sometimes seen around the edges of a face.
Non-Destructive Workflow: Because it integrates directly as a Lightroom plugin, it maintains your metadata and allows for round-trip editing without losing the original raw data.
Preset Management: This build includes a library of presets—ranging from "Normal" to "Glamour"—which serve as excellent starting points for batch processing large galleries like weddings or corporate headshots.
Performance Stability: For Mac users, build 4033 addresses specific stability issues found in earlier 4.0 releases, ensuring smoother performance on both Intel and Apple Silicon (M1/M2/M3) architectures through Rosetta 2 or native support. How to Use Build 4033 in Your Workflow
Selection: In Lightroom, select your photo and go to Photo > Edit In > Imagenomic Portraiture 4.
The Auto-Mask: Upon opening, the plugin automatically creates a skin mask. You can use the "eyedropper" tool to fine-tune the specific skin tones you want to target.
Detail Control: Use the Smoothing sliders to adjust the intensity. A pro tip is to keep the "Fine" slider higher than the "Medium" or "Large" sliders to maintain natural skin texture (pores) while removing blotchiness.
Enhancements: This build allows for subtle adjustments to warmth, brightness, and contrast specifically within the skin mask, helping you fix lighting issues without affecting the background. Why This Specific Version Matters

B. Code Signing & Notarization (macOS Specific)
- Context: macOS requires developers to sign their apps and notarize them with Apple to ensure they are malware-free.
- Risk: "Cracked" software intentionally breaks the developer's code signature to bypass licensing checks. This renders the file "unsigned" or signed with a fake certificate.
- Consequence: Running unsigned code bypasses macOS security guarantees (Gatekeeper), potentially allowing the execution of embedded malware.

3. The "Threshold" & "Softness" Sliders
Unlike simple blur filters, Portraiture uses a threshold system:
- Small Details: Controls pores and fine wrinkles.
- Medium Details: Controls sunspots and acne.
- Large Details: Controls lighting contours (shadows on cheeks). By adjusting these, users can achieve anything from a natural "skin clean-up" to a high-fashion glossy finish.
